Many adults choose to pay for private assessments because NHS services are inefficient and waiting lists are at an all-time high. BBC's Panorama program exposed a few clinics prescribing stimulants, and presenting unqualified ADHD diagnoses.

A diagnosis of ADHD should be confirmed by a psychiatrist, or an appropriately qualified specialist doctor or nurse. A psychiatrist should also be able to prescribe medication.

general-medical-council-logo.pngAn interview with the family of the patient will be part of a psychiatric evaluation. They will want to know the signs and symptoms, as well as how they affect the school, work and relationships. It is also important to bring any medical records you have.

The doctor will also assess the patient's mood as well as their history of mental health issues. They will want to know about any other physical or emotional issues that may be causing the symptoms of ADHD. They will also search for evidence of a genetic predisposition to the disorder.

Medicines

Unmanaged ADHD symptoms can have serious implications for people's professional, personal, and general well-being. This can make it difficult to maintain friendships, cause issues at home or at work and may lead to serious depression. The NHS states that the most effective treatment for ADHD is the combination of behavior therapy and medication. Medications such as stimulants can be very efficient in managing ADHD symptoms. These are class B substances and are controlled under the Misuse of Drugs Act.

There are many types of ADHD medications and different ones may be better suited to different individuals. Your doctor will decide the best medication for you based on your medical history and mental health issues within the family, and the other medications you are taking. Some sufferers might have mild side effects that will improve over time. Some of the most common side effects are headaches, stomach upsets, and fatigue. You might need to see your doctor on a regular basis since he will be observing how well the medication is working for you. He will assess your weight, height, and the rate at which you beat. Symptoms of ADHD generally are classified into two categories: hyperactivity and inattention or the tendency to be impulsive. These behaviors are common in everyone, but those with ADHD display them regularly and consistently. Inattention symptoms include difficulty following directions, becoming distracted easily, losing track of conversations or daydreaming frequently and having difficulty finishing tasks or meeting deadlines. Impulsiveness includes being inconsiderate, speaking out of the blue, or spending money without thinking. ADHD sufferers often feel anxious or fidgety, and have trouble planning and organising.
